Mavenir Demonstrates Automated Deployment of Cloud-Native 5G Core at MWC LA

21.10.2019 16:00:00 EEST | Business Wire | Press release

Share

Mobile World Congress: Mavenir, a US-based Network Software Provider, and the industry's only end-to-end cloud-native vendor for CSPs, announced today its 5G Core platform, which includes a comprehensive set of 5G core functions on a containerized cloud-native platform. The decomposition of functions into these modular units provides the operators the flexibility to scale them independently; scalability and flexibility that wasn’t possible with 4G EPC.

Mavenir has invested heavily in developing the 5G Core solution from the ground-up on cloud-native principles that can still be retrofitted on EPCs. The solution encompasses all the major 5G core elements, such as AMF, SMF, UPF, NRF, UDSF, PCF, UDM, UDR, NSSF, AUSF, BSF, N3IWF, SCP, SEPP, and SMSF. All these functions are implemented as micro-services in containers. In addition, Mavenir is also building remaining 5G core functions, NEF, 5G-EIR, NWDAF etc.

The Mavenir 5G Core also combines 4G EPC functionality and offers a ‘Converged Mobile Core’ solution that supports both 4G and 5G subscribers. In addition, the Mavenir 5G Core supports all Standalone (SA) and Non-Standalone (NSA) options. This includes 5G SA Option 2 and Option 5, as well as 5G NSA Option 4 and Option 7. With this comprehensive solution, operators will be able to support in parallel existing 4G subscribers, deploy new commercial grade 5G use cases and reap the benefit of a full array of features and capabilities that 5G promises in early 2020.

Mavenir’s investment in building the 5G Core in a future proof way has generated tremendous interest from service providers around the globe. Mavenir’s 5G Core is being tested at Tier-1 operators in Asia Pacific, Europe and in North America.

At Mobile World Congress Los Angeles, Mavenir will be showcasing the deployment of 6 different 5GC CNFs. Mavenir’s 5G Core solution will be demonstrated along with automation to deploy the Container as a Service (CaaS) and Platform as a Service (PaaS) based on Cloud Native Computing Foundation (CNCF) open source components. To complement the leading edge 5G Core solution, Mavenir has developed automation of deployment and configuration of the CaaS, PaaS and 5G Core Container Network Functions (CNFs).
